Natalie Off Duty
Natalie Off Duty is an eclectic mix of travel, fashion, self-portraits, collages and general inspiration from the world that surrounds model Natalie Suarez. The natural stylist behind the LA-based blog effortlessly pulls together chic, fashion-forward outfits injected with a huge dose of LA cool. Her whimsical travel posts inspire envy in even the most travel-savvy individual. And her knock-out outfits make her blog an inspiration and a must-read. Everyday.
Tangent Digital asked Natalie all about style à la LA.
TD: What inspired you to start a blog?
NS: I was introduced to fashion blogs from my sister and was really fascinated by them. I found blogs so inspiring and so much fun to read everyday. I have always loved fashion and putting together different looks from my wardrobe so I thought, “why not blog about it?”
TD: Describe LA style.
NS: LA style is super laid back and casual. Jeans and a T-shirt are the norm. I love how people don’t really try so hard to get dressed up here. There are so many young people in LA who make casual dressing look really good.
TD: Celebrity, designer or model – do you have a person in particular whose style do you admire?
NS: I admire so many different people’s style! Those that have really stood out to me though would have to be Dree Hemingway, Erin Wasson, and Daria Werbowy.
TD: As a model you get to travel a lot, does your personal style reflect this?
NS: Everywhere I go, I try to get little pieces here and there to add to my wardrobe. I look for bracelets and rings that I can wear everyday that bring back memories of my travels.
TD: What designers do you keep coming back to?
NS: I love Alexander Wang, Chloe, Dries Van Noten, and Proenza Schouler. They are all so different from one another, but I admire them all. I don’t stick to one look so a variety of designer clothing appeals to me.
TD: Do you have a signature item?
NS: My black booties. I’m always wearing them!
TD: Describe your typical Saturday night ensemble.
NS: Black leather pants, structured shoulder blazer, a tee, and booties. I could wear this everyday.
